UAE Classifies Khor Mor Attack as Terrorism, International Violation

The United Arab Emirates (UAE) strongly condemned the attack on the Khor Mor gas field in Sulaymaniyah Governorate, which resulted in the deaths of four Yemeni employees and the injuries of several others. The UAE characterises this incident as an act of terrorism and a clear breach of international standards.
"The UAE strongly condemns the terrorist attacks aimed at destroying security and stability in Iraq, which are a flagrant violation of the principles of international law," the UAE Foreign Ministry said in a statement on Saturday, April 27, 2024.
The statement said the UAE supports all measures taken by Iraq to protect its sovereignty, security, and stability and fight terrorism.
There are currently five companies involved in gas production in the Khor Mor gas field, two of which are UAE's Dana Gas and Hilal. Khor Mor stands as the most expansive natural gas field in both the Kurdistan Region and Iraq.
On Friday evening, April 26, 2024, two drone strikes occurred at the Khor Mor gas field in Sulaymaniyah Governorate, resulting in the deaths of four Yemenis and the injuries of four others. The origin of the drones remains unidentified, and an investigation has been launched into the incident.
The drone strike is the second this year, and a committee of inquiry has been formed by the Iraqi and Kurdistan Regional Governments.
The incident was condemned by the United States, UK, France, United Nations, and European Union, who all demanded a prompt inquiry and punishment for those responsible.
